We took a CCL excursion to Gumbalimba. wonderful trip. the only part that was a little "cheesy" was, you walk into a cave and there are pirate statues around. guide explains history of the island etc.

 

The botanical gardens are beautiful. You walk over a suspended wooden bridge to get to the area that has birds and monkeys.

 

the macaws were the largest i've ever seen and just exquisite. nice area.

 

the monkeys are friendly for the most part. However, they can nip you. do no where hats and hide what ever you can in your pockets as they will try and steal anything on your person.

 

Overall it was a nice excursion. I would recommend it at least once. :)
